The Cavern via Charred Deepening occupies the dark, muted end of the green spectrum, defined by its coordinates #222b22 — RGB(34, 43, 34).

#222b22RGB(34, 43, 34)

HSL 120° · 12% saturation · 15% lightness

Design use

Practically speaking, this deep green is most at home as a primary background in dark themes, a strong border or divider, or a headline colour against a light surface. Combine with lighter tints of the same hue for a cohesive palette.

🎭

Colour pairings

When it comes to colour harmony, for a natural palette, combine this green with terracotta, ochre, and warm cream. For a bolder approach, its complement — a warm red-magenta — creates immediate impact.
